See also our theoretical yield calculator for chemical reactions (probably your … When oxygen is plentiful, butane burns to form carbon dioxide and water vapor; when oxygen is limited, carbon (soot) or carbon monoxide may also be formed. Butane is denser than air. When there is sufficient oxygen: 2 C4H10 + 13 O2 → 8 CO2 + 10 H2O

WebThe mass spectrometer observes the mass to charge ratio (m/z).Most of the time, small organic molecules like butane will be singly charged by the ionizer, which means that the mass can be read off directly since z =1.. If butane was somehow ionized to the +2 state, then the mass spec would observe 58/2=29, which is the mass of butane (58 g/mol) … Webn-Butane. Molecular Formula CH. Average mass 58.122 Da. WebButane is an organic compound with the formula C4H10. Butane is a saturated hydrocarbon containing 4 carbons, with an unbranched structure.
